Overview

Kochi-based full-service broker offering three online pricing plans plus offline advisory, Flip and FundsGenie analytics, and global investing access.

Best for: Investors wanting advisory plus a volume-linked F&O plan.

Fees & charges

Account charges

Account openingOne-time charge to open your demat + trading account. Many discount brokers have made this free.
₹0 (free)✓ Verified 14/9/2026
Annual maintenance (AMC)Yearly demat maintenance, charged by the broker (separate from CDSL/NSDL custodian fees). Often free for the first year.
Zero AMC promo (till 31 Mar 2027)✓ Verified 14/9/2026

Equity

Equity deliveryBrokerage when you buy shares and hold them overnight or longer. This is the charge long-term investors should minimise.
0.30% online (0.50% offline)✓ Verified 14/9/2026
IntradayBrokerage on same-day buy-sell trades. Percentage caps (e.g. 0.03%) protect small orders from the flat fee.
0.03% online (0.05% offline)✓ Verified 14/9/2026
DP charge (sell)Charged when shares leave your demat on a sell (delivery). Goes mostly to the depository, not the broker.
Sale via Geojit 0.02% (min ₹30, max ₹75)✓ Verified 14/9/2026

Derivatives (F&O)

OptionsPer-order charge for options buying/selling. Excludes STT, exchange and SEBI charges, which apply equally everywhere.
₹20/₹15/₹10 per lot by volume (G-Trade Max)✓ Verified 14/9/2026
FuturesPer-order charge for futures trades. Same statutory extras as options apply on top.
₹40/₹30/₹20 per lot by volume (G-Trade Max)✓ Verified 14/9/2026

How to open a Geojit account

  1. Start your application

    Open the Geojit signup with your mobile number and email — it takes about 10 minutes.

  2. Complete e-KYC

    Verify with PAN, Aadhaar-based OTP, a live selfie and your bank proof (cancelled cheque or statement).

  3. E-sign documents

    Digitally sign the account-opening form and nomination details via Aadhaar e-sign.

  4. Get your client ID

    Activation usually takes 24–48 hours. Your login credentials arrive by email and SMS.
